How Much Does a Demographer Make Per Year? Average Demographer Price
A Demographer studies the makeup, distribution and trends of population and observes the causes as well as effects of population changes. Sometimes demographers are called “population sociologists”. A demographer collects statistical data in order to identify the trends and comes up with assumptions regarding the future trends which assist the Government and other organizations to develop plan for the future. In the United States, a demographer can make as much as $53,160 on an average per year.
